Gavin Friday performs at Pat McCabe book launch

On February 8, 2001, Gavin performed a set at the Clarence Hotel in Dublin for a Pat McCabe book launch.

Our man on the scene reported: “An hour and a half reading by Pat, followed later in the Clarence by a set by Gav that included various folk and parlour songs. Then a duet with himself and Pat of the The Stylistics ‘I can’t give you anything, but my love’ which got the whole room singing.

Shane MCGowan sang ‘Grainne Bhuil’, Jack L had the whole room singing the hymn-like ‘Old Man River’. The set was finished with Gav singing ‘Sweet Jane’.”
